Abstract
A suite of Matlab programs has been developed as part of the book “Orthogonal Polynomials: Computation and Approximation” Oxford University Press, Oxford, 2004, by Gautschi. The package contains routines for generating orthogonal polynomials as well as routines dealing with applications. In this paper, a brief review of the first part of the package is given, dealing with procedures for generating the three-term recurrence relation for orthogonal polynomials and more general recurrence relations for Sobolev orthogonal polynomials. Moment-based methods and discretization methods, and their implementation in Matlab, are among the principal topics discussed.
